Description

The Golden Hour Mobile Series Container is a light-weight blood transport capable of carrying four units of whole blood and keeping the stored blood cool for up to 72 hours, regardless of weather conditions. As the winner of the coveted US Army's Greatest Invention Award, the Series S Container helps deliver whole blood or platelets needed to save lives during the critical first hour after injury. This extremely light-weight container will securely and reliably transport blood and platelets to wherever it is needed most. With Golden Hour technology users will experience a reduction to distribution costs, payload risks, and environmental impacts.

Utilizing Thermal Isolation Chamber System (TIC™) technology and vacuum insulation panels, the Golden Hour Series S Container will keep the payload isolated from exposure to extreme temperatures with a tight, protective thermal seal for a pre-determined temperature range and duration. Safely deliver whole blood and blood supplies from anywhere in the world — to where they need it most. The containers are easy to assemble, reusable parcels that are constructed of reusable non-toxic materials.

Specs
  • Ultra-light storage and transport up to 4 units of whole blood
  • Maintains 2°C - 8°C for 72 hours or more
  • Dismount for up to 12 hours without external power
  • Equip to make blood in far forward areas accessible
  • Capacity: 2L

Dimensions:

  • W 9.25 in. x H 8 in. x D 8.25 in.
  • Weight: 7.80 lbs
